- En el intrincado mundo de la computación, el firmware juega un papel crucial como el software de bajo nivel que interactúa directamente con el hardware de un dispositivo. Uno de los componentes esenciales del firmware es la partición de firmware.
- Este artículo profundizará en el concepto de partición de firmware, sus características y su propósito.
Las particiones de firmware son un aspecto fundamental de los dispositivos de computación modernos, ya que proporcionan una base segura y confiable para el funcionamiento y la gestión del dispositivo. A medida que la tecnología continúa evolucionando, la importancia de comprender e implementar correctamente las particiones de firmware no hará más que crecer.
¿Qué es la partición de firmware?
El firmware es un tipo de microcódigo o programa que proporciona el nivel más bajo de control sobre un dispositivo de hardware. Normalmente se almacena en memoria no volátil y es responsable de la configuración inicial del dispositivo, así como de gestionar el sistema básico de entrada/salida (BIOS) de una computadora.
Una partición de firmware es una sección dedicada del almacenamiento de un dispositivo que está específicamente reservada para almacenar el código de firmware. Esta partición es distinta de otras áreas de almacenamiento y está diseñada para protegerse contra sobrescrituras o eliminaciones accidentales, garantizando la integridad del arranque y el funcionamiento del dispositivo.
Lea también: ¿Qué es el firmware de un router y cuáles son sus funciones?
Características clave de la partición de firmware
Almacenamiento no volátil: La resistencia de las particiones de firmware es evidente en su uso de memoria no volátil, lo que garantiza que los datos críticos persistan a través de los ciclos de energía. Esta característica es fundamental para el funcionamiento confiable de los dispositivos, ya que garantiza que el firmware permanezca intacto y accesible en todo momento.
Almacenamiento del cargador de arranque: Como primer punto de contacto entre el hardware y el sistema operativo, el cargador de arranque almacenado en las particiones de firmware inicia la secuencia de inicio del sistema. Es responsable de inicializar los componentes de hardware y cargar el kernel, lo que lo convierte en un componente fundamental del proceso de arranque del dispositivo.
Mecanismo de actualización: Las particiones de firmware están equipadas con sofisticados mecanismos de actualización que permiten actualizaciones de firmware sin problemas. Estos mecanismos no solo facilitan la aplicación de parches de seguridad sino que también garantizan que los dispositivos reciban las últimas funciones y mejoras, mejorando así el rendimiento y la confiabilidad.
Funciones de recuperación: Para protegerse contra la posible corrupción o falla del firmware principal, algunas particiones incorporan sólidas funciones de recuperación. Estas herramientas pueden detectar automáticamente problemas, volver a una versión anterior del firmware o incluso realizar un restablecimiento de fábrica, lo que garantiza que el dispositivo pueda restaurarse a su plena funcionalidad.
Aislamiento: Las particiones de firmware suelen estar aisladas de las áreas de almacenamiento principales para protegerlas contra accesos no autorizados y pérdida accidental de datos. Esta separación es crucial para mantener la integridad y seguridad del firmware, ya que minimiza el riesgo de manipulación o corrupción.
Tamaño y optimización: El tamaño de las particiones de firmware está optimizado para equilibrar el almacenamiento de los componentes esenciales del firmware con los recursos de memoria disponibles. Esta optimización garantiza que el dispositivo pueda utilizar eficientemente su capacidad de almacenamiento y, al mismo tiempo, proporcionar la funcionalidad de firmware necesaria.
Comprender estas características es crucial para los desarrolladores y profesionales de TI que trabajan con actualizaciones de firmware y mantenimiento de dispositivos. La gestión y utilización adecuadas de las particiones de firmware pueden afectar significativamente la seguridad, el rendimiento y la experiencia general del usuario de los dispositivos informáticos.
Lea también: ¿Qué es la ingeniería de firmware y cuáles son sus aplicaciones?
Propósito de las particiones de firmware
La inicialización del dispositivo es un proceso crucial, ya que las particiones de firmware juegan un papel clave en el arranque de los componentes de hardware del dispositivo. Estas particiones también contribuyen a la seguridad del dispositivo al habilitar funciones como el arranque seguro, lo que garantiza un entorno operativo seguro. Además, simplifican las tareas de mantenimiento al permitir actualizaciones de firmware sencillas, lo que en última instancia mejora la funcionalidad del dispositivo y soluciona cualquier error que pueda surgir.

